I was doing this, but can't ethically support Steem in its current state.

To answer your question, it's a sticky situation to post the same content on both. There are those on both sides downvoting these articles. I'll say that it's worse on the Steem side though.

On Steem any post that contains the word Hive is not shown on any of the frontends. Justin is censoring them, all of them. The best way is to post to Hive first, then to Steem. Make sure all reference to Hive is nowhere in your Steem article.

You'll probably get by doing this for a while, but once you are found out on the Steem side, your articles will be downvoted to zero.

If you start participating in Steem seriously, your articles on Hive will probably start being downvoted by big accounts as well.

So, dip your toes in cautiously. Really, the value of Steem is so much lower and the spread is most likely only going to get wider, that it's not really worth it.

Also, all the big curators are on Hive. Unless you are receiving big autovotes on Steem, your content will not see much interaction.
